The Festival Highlights: A Two-Day Celebration
This year marks the seventh edition of the Mar y Christmas festival, a beloved tradition that never fails to draw enthusiastic crowds. Activities kick off on Saturday with the marina boardwalk transformed into a mini Christmas fair showcasing regional delicacies, unique crafts sold by local artisans, and lively musical performances. Meanwhile, Medano Beach serves as a stunning backdrop for aerial displays featuring mermaids and performers in kayaks—a visual treat that adds to the fun!
On Sunday, the main event begins around 5:30 p.m., wherein a parade of over 25 beautifully decorated boats takes to the bay. They set sail from the 8 Cascadas area and make their way towards the marina, providing breathtaking views as dusk turns into a vibrant night filled with glittering lights.
Prime Viewing Spots for the Perfect Experience
Location is key when it comes to witnessing this spectacular event. Here are the top recommended viewing areas:
- Medano Beach: Often dubbed the 'front-row seat', this beach’s location allows visitors to see the parade up close, with the soothing sounds of waves in the background. Many beachfront resorts often host their own festivities, adding extra magic to the evening.
- The Marina Boardwalk: Positioned at the parade's conclusion, the marina offers a bustling atmosphere, with food stands, local crafts, and live entertainment surrounding you—a festive hub that immerses you in the local culture.
- The “Two-View” Strategy: To maximize your experience, consider starting at Medano for the early parade, then transitioning to the marina for the later, celebratory atmosphere. This strategy provides a contrasting experience, shifting from natural beach vibes to a lively urban ambiance.
